The psychological facet of gambling is a major Consider its popular enchantment. Profitable releases dopamine, the Mind’s pleasure chemical, creating a sensation of excitement that keeps gamers coming back for more. The “in the vicinity of-skip” result—whenever a participant Virtually wins—can trick the Mind into pondering success is just around the corner, fueling additional betting. Many gamblers drop into your pattern of “chasing losses,” believing that another wager can help them recover preceding losses. This cycle may lead to compulsive gambling, which negatively influences own funds, relationships, and mental overall health.
